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ions
Mac OS X versions 10.4.11 and 10.5.6
Description
The issue is related to an unspecified vulnerability in the Pixlet codec, which can be triggered by a crafted movie file. This can cause memory corruption, leading to a denial of service (application termination) and potentially allowing the execution of arbitrary code.
